I like reading the Rogers Innovation Reports as they tend to have lots of interesting info that’s relevant to Canadians. In the latest edition of the Innovation Report, Rogers reveals the different ways Canadians watch entertainment and the influence of mobile devices in these habits:
- Canadians out of 10 owning a mobile device use their mobile device while watching TV, 33% use a smartphone or phablet and 15% a tablet
- More than 80% Canadians are practicing marathon TV watching and have watched 3 or more TV episodes or 2 movies. Among them 58% have done so over a smartphone or phablet. Do you see yourself spending more than 4 hours in a row watching your smartphone?
- Using a mobile device means people get out of their couch and watch TV content on their mobile in their bed , while eating alone or when doing chores. It’s TV everywhere!
